Hashim Ali’s TEDx talk, “The No Man’s Land of Becoming,” is a raw and honest reflection on failure, identity, and the painful uncertainty of being stuck between where you came from and where you hope to be. Through deeply personal experiences, he speaks about the emotional weight of feeling like a failure and the difficulty of existing in a space where you are neither who you once were nor who you are trying to become. The talk explores the loneliness, confusion, and self-doubt that often accompany growth, while shedding light on the invisible struggles people face during periods of transition. Vulnerable yet deeply empowering, it reminds audiences that the “no man’s land” of becoming is often where the most important transformation begins. Hashim Ali is a prominent Pakistani visual artist, production designer, and art director known for his richly textured, storybook-like sets that merge historical grandeur with contemporary aesthetics.
